A block has the dimensions L, 2 L, and 3 L . When one of the L × 2 L faces is maintained at the temperature T 1 and the other L × 2 L face is held at the temperature T 2 , the rate of heat conduction through the block is P . Answer the following questions in terms of P . (a) What is the rate of heat conduction in this block if one of the L × 3 L faces is held at the temperature T 1 and the other L × 3 L face is held at the temperature T 2 ? (b) What is the rate of heat conduction in this block if one of the 2 L × 3 L faces is held at the temperature T 1 and the other 2 L × 3 L face is held at the temperature T 2 ?
